LEADERSOFT.ru Разработка на заказ программ и сайтов
Форумы по информационным технологиям
 
Регистрация  |  Вход
left
Форумы Минимизировать
ПоискСписок форумов
  Программирование  Microsoft Access. Файлы mdb и accdb  ленточные формы...
 ленточные формы
 
 15.05.2008 15:19:36
romuld
1 сообщения


ленточные формы
Здравствуйте! Подскажите, можно ли средствами Access решить проблему:
1) Есть таблица, и запрос к ней, выбирающий некоторые записи по условию (WHERE table1.f1 = value).
2) value берется с верхней части ленточной формы - т.е. это пользователь нечто выбрал.
3) Результат запроса размещается в области данных этой ленточной формы.
4) Пользователь должен ввести новую запись, у которой значение поля f1 уже определено выше. Пользователь не должен вручную вводить это значение. Кроме того, хотелось бы автоматически заполнять еще какие то невидимые пользователю поля записи.

Но при создании новой записи в это поле f1 кладется нулевое значение. Я не понимаю, как можно повлиять на значения полей, которые будут класться в таблицу, и не отображаться в форме.
Ладно, я ставлю текстовое поле в область данных, привязанное к полю f1. Во всех строках, относящихся к выборке, значения те что нужно. Но в новой записи текстовое поле содержит 0 ! Как сделать так, что бы там стояло то что мне нужно?
 20.05.2008 8:08:27
Saladin
2 сообщения


Re: ленточные формы
Как вариант можно скопировать существующюю запись, а после - написать заполнение нужных полей нужными значениями (по умолчанию при добавлении новой записи она делается текущей)
 26.05.2008 15:03:01
Admin1
731 сообщения
1-ый


Re: ленточные формы

Например, после обновления поля можно изменить его значение по умолчанию. Второй вариант - это использование таблицы, в ней также есть свойство для изменения значения по умолчанию.

Private Sub Поле1_AfterUpdate()
    Me.Поле1.DefaultValue = 5
    Me.Поле1.DefaultValue = "'Новое значение'"
    Me.Поле1.DefaultValue = Me.Поле1
End Sub

  Программирование  Microsoft Access. Файлы mdb и accdb  ленточные формы...
ПоискПоиск  Список форумовСписок форумов  
right